They're tiny, they're tenacious and they're here.
Humans have advanced dangerously since the last visit in 1494 and are a threat to the mission.
Volume 1. in the Alyon adventure book series. - The first in a series of four books.

A fun-filled, action-packed, Scifi / fact adventure for ages 9 and up. An easy read, with mild peril, in the tradition of Star Trek, Broccoli Boy, SeaQuest, Beast Quest, and Thunderbirds.
Google the codes and dates hidden in the story, to discover real world people, places, pop culture, and events. Discover the SolarSystem, the Earth, Volcanoes and Sharks through the eyes of tiny heroes.
Use a magnifying glass to read the hidden letters within the Alyon writing. Ideal for fans of computer games, action movies, space tech, science, and nature.

- I have read far too many Terry Pratchett books far too many times -

Having studied professional make-up art, interior and graphic design, Jennifer went on to sculpt Disney toys, Wedgewood collectables and mad things for cereal boxes, and also worked in the creature departments on Harry Potter and the Philosopher’s stone and The Mummy Returns.
When not writing, Jennifer is a sculptor currently living on the Isle of Wight in the UK.
